Handover for release 4.2 of the Gildhall seat-map renderer. Zoom-level glitch on balcony tiers fixed; fix for wheelchair-row overlays still pending, flagged behind config. Do not enable the overlay flag in prod until QA signs off. Perf budget holding at 120ms render. Open issues, test matrix, and rollout checklist are all tracked on the page below.

runbook for badug-kadup: https://confluence.zemvarlabs.internal/projects/browse/display/projects/bd1b

Welcome to on-call for the Glimmerpane design system! Our snapshot tests live in the `snapcheck` suite and run on every merge to main. If a UI component changes visually, the diff bot flags it — usually it's an intentional tweak, so just approve the new baseline. If it's 2am and snapshots are failing across the board, it's almost always a font-loading race, not your problem. To unlock the baseline store and re-approve snapshots in bulk, use the recovery passphrase below.

recovery phrase for tahag-taguf: wenix-caswyn

# Environments: PinPoint Autocomplete

Three environments: dev, staging, prod. Dev resets nightly. Staging mirrors prod data minus the Harwick dataset. Promotions go dev → staging → prod; no direct prod pushes. Staging smoke tests must pass before release sign-off. Prod config is locked behind change review. Current staging values are as follows.

settings of kafop-fahog:
PRAWYN_PIN=8793
PRAWYN_METRICS_HOST=metrics.prawyn.lumiccorp.corp
PRAWYN_LOG_LEVEL=warn
PRAWYN_TENANT=kasox

Handover — Gridwright crossword generator. The nightly puzzle batch ran clean, but the theme-word service on staging is flaky; restart it if generation stalls past ten minutes. Deploys are frozen until the clue-dedup fix lands. If the secrets store locks during a restart (it did twice this week), you'll need to re-open it manually. Use the recovery passphrase written just below.

unlock words, tagaf-hahif: ralwyn-lammir-rusax-sormir

Onboarding: SquatterScan (support)

SquatterScan flags typo-squatting packages in the Fennelhub registry. Customers report false positives via the support queue. Check the verdict page first; most tickets close with a whitelist entry. Escalate confirmed malware to the registry team. Whitelist edits need the admin console, which is gated behind the recovery store. Unlock the store with the passphrase below.

unlock words, yahip-hahop: casath-oliox